The Legend of the Crystal Seas
In a world not too far from ours, there was a kingdom named Maritimus, renowned for its sprawling oceans, known as the Crystal Seas. The kingdom bloomed with magnificent flora and fauna beneath its serene surface, which glittered under sunlight. It was far more majestic than Venice, as divine as the sky above, and as serene as a poet's imagination.
One day, a charming baby boy came into the kingdom. He was no ordinary child; he was the son of Victoria, the queen of Maritimus. The boy was named Orion, carrying the legacy of a legendary warrior attributed with his name. Orion's father had been a courageous king who sacrificed his life protecting Maritimus. Hence, Orion was the sole heir to the kingdom of the Crystal Seas. Growing up, he was groomed to be compassionate, brave, and wise, thereby carrying the burden of his father's lost crown.
Outside the walls of Maritimus, under the shadow of the mighty mountains, resided a dark wizard named Morosus. He had a heart filled with envy for Maritimus's prosperity and was insatiable for power. A destroyed city, where darkness dwelled, and echoes of happiness were lost, was Morosus's abode. He longed for a world of his vicious dreams to come true and aimed to gain control of Maritimus to make that happen.
As Orion grew, he was taught about Morosus and the potential danger the kingdom could face. Orion hence committed to building strength and gathering knowledge to defend his motherland. On the other end, Morosus steadily gathered his strength, cultivating a powerful spell bound to bring the walls of Maritimus down and establish a reign of terror.
The fateful day finally arrived. Morosus, ready with his army and powerful spell, stormed Maritimus. Seeing his beloved kingdom under threat, courage sparked within Orion. Clad in his father's armor and holding the ancient trident, he led his army bravely into the fierce battle.
Meanwhile, Queen Victoria prayed to the Spirit of the Crystal Seas, pleading for her son and their kingdom. As the battle intensified, a radiant light shone from the Crystal Seas. A majestic sea creature, Seraphina, appeared before the queen. A guardian appointed by the Spirit of the Seas, Seraphina promised to help Maritimus out of its misery.
On the battlefield, Orion and Morosus clashed fiercely, the wizard was more powerful than ever. Just as he was about to cast a decisive spell, a wave of vibrant energy emerged from the Crystal Seas. It was Seraphina. On seeing this, Orion remembered his mother's tales of the guardian.
Seraphina breathed life into the kingdom's soldiers while casting a protective shield around Orion, helping him resist Morosus's spell. Using this to his advantage, Orion lunged at the dark wizard, striking him down with a mighty blow and ending the tyranny once and for all.
In the wake of Morosus's defeat, Orion was hailed as the hero of Maritimus. The Crystal Seas shimmered gleamingly as the kingdom celebrated their victory. With peace restored, Orion pledged his life to safeguard his kingdom. Seraphina went back into the crystal depths, promising to emerge whenever Maritimus would need her.
In the end, this legendary saga of Orion, Maritimus, and the Crystal Seas became an emblem of courage, unity, and wisdom echoing through the ages, residing in the hearts of the kingdom's folks. As our tale ends here, it is said that the kingdom holds its chin high under Orion's rule and the gleaming guardian watch of the Crystal Seas.
